Product Overview

The TecMark 4037P pressure switch is engineered for demanding industrial applications where precise pressure control and long‑term reliability are essential. With a 21 A current rating and a single‑pole single‑throw (SPST) configuration, the device provides clean, on‑off switching without the risk of false triggering. The lever‑type actuator offers tactile feedback and easy manual operation, while the 1/8″ male pipe thread (MPT) connector allows straightforward integration into existing pneumatic and hydraulic circuits. Constructed from durable metal contacts and sealed to an IP54 rating, the switch resists dust ingress and water splashes, extending service life even in harsh environments. Compact dimensions of 2.8 × 1.85 × 1.8 inches and a lightweight design of 1.44 ounces make it suitable for space‑constrained panels and control boxes. Certified by TecMark Corporation, the 4037P meets industry standards for safety and performance, delivering consistent operation across a wide temperature range.

FAQ

What is the maximum current the 4037P can handle?

The switch is rated for a continuous current of 21 A, making it suitable for most medium‑size industrial circuits.

Can the switch be used in wet environments?

With an IP54 rating, the device tolerates water splashes and dust, so it can be installed in damp or semi‑outdoor locations where occasional moisture is present.

Is the 1/8″ MPT thread compatible with standard pneumatic fittings?

Yes, the 1/8″ male pipe thread matches common pneumatic connections, allowing you to attach the switch directly to standard tubing without additional adapters.
